Rodney Dangerfield portrays Thornton Mellon, a clothing store tycoon ("Big & Fat Stores") who returns to college and gets NASA to do his son's astronomy homework. Mellon even tells Kurt Vonnegut to go fuck himself. Action centers around a diving meet where Mellon performs the legendary "Triple Lindy," an act he learned off the boardwalk at Atlantic City.

In addition to a solid performance by Dangerfield (real name: Jacob Cohen), Back to School features some great supporting roles. Robert Downey Jr. plays the geek: "That's something you never see ... a heckler at a diving meet." Also with Sam Kinison as a totally insane history teacher. And Burt Young as the tough but philosophical limo driver ("I put one kid through college; I put the other through a wall.").
